    Randy Wittman

    American basketball player and coach

    Randy Scott Wittman (born October 28, 1959) is an American former basketball player at the guard position and former coach of the NBA's Cleveland Cavaliers, Minnesota Timberwolves, and Washington Wizards.

    Playing career

    High school

    Wittman starred for IndianapolisBen Davis High School from 1975 to 1978.

    College

    The 6'6" Wittman played college basketball from 1979 to 1983 for Bob Knight and the Indiana University Hoosiers.
